The Rich Heritage of Italian Herbalism
Long before modern drug stores controlled the high street, Italians count on the erboristeria (herbalist shop) for their health needs. Italian herbalism draws heavily on Mediterranean flora, making use of plants that grow in the unique environment of the peninsula.
Traditional Italian herbal items typically focus on:
- Digestive health: Bitter liqueurs (amari) and organic teas (tisane) consumed after heavy meals.
- Skin care: Olive oil-based salves, calendula creams, and rosewater distillates.
- Respiratory support: Eucalyptus, pine extracts, and mountain honey infusions.
- Relaxation: Lavender from the hills of Piedmont and chamomile from the Po Valley.
Must-Buy Herbal Products in Italy
When searching for herbal items in Italy, particular products stick out for their extraordinary quality and cultural significance.
1. Tisane (Herbal Teas) and Infusions
Italian organic teas are not just for winter season; they are crafted for specific health goals. Popular blends include drenante (draining/detoxifying), digestiva (gastrointestinal), and rilassante (relaxing).
2. Amari and Medicinal Elixirs
Historically produced by monks, Italian amari (bitters) utilize roots, barks, flowers, and herbs steeped in alcohol. While lots of are enjoyed as after-dinner drinks, conventional solutions from monasteries are still valued for their digestive homes.
3. Vital Oils and Carrier Oils
Thanks to the varied geography of Italy, vital oils originated from in your area grown rosemary, thyme, lemon, bergamot, and sweet orange are incredibly potent.
4. Natural Cosmetics and Soaps
Italian craftsmen soaps, typically enriched with Tuscan olive oil, goat's milk, and local herbs, are world-renowned.

If you are browsing racks and feel overwhelmed by options, keep an eye out for these respected Italian brand names known for their dedication to quality and sustainability:
- Aboca: Based in the hills of Tuscany, Aboca is a pioneer in 100% natural, naturally degradable healthcare items and scientifically confirmed natural solutions.
- L'Erbolario: Originating from Lodi, this precious brand name offers a large series of cruelty-free, plant-based cosmetics and perfumes influenced by traditional dishes.
- Erba Vita: A San Marino-based business known for high-quality food supplements, herbal teas, and single-herb extracts.
- Spezieria di Palazzo Farnese: Offering products connected to historical monastic recipes, best for those looking for standard elixirs.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Can I bring Italian herbal items back through customs?
Usually, yes, as long as they are commercially packaged, sealed, and plainly identified. Nevertheless, prevent bringing raw, unrefined seeds, fresh plant matter, or homemade items including fresh animal fats, as these may breach agricultural import laws in your house nation.
Do I need a prescription to buy natural remedies in Italy?
No. Over the counter organic supplements, teas, cosmetics, and necessary oils can be acquired easily without a prescription Acquistare Farmaci Senza Ricetta In Italia erboristerie and parafarmacie.
Are Italian organic products more costly than routine cosmetics?
Artisanal and high-end botanical brands like L'Erbolario or Aboca may cost somewhat more than mass-market grocery store brand names, but the price reflects superior natural sourcing, high concentrations of active botanical components, and rigorous European manufacturing standards.
Can I discover vegan and cruelty-free herbal items in Italy?
Definitely. Italy has a quickly growing market for ethical wellness. Most modern-day erboristerie proudly stock vegan, cruelty-free, and plastic-free beauty and health products.
